Choosing an Online Multimedia Program

Students earning their bachelor’s degree in multimedia design work toward careers in creative industries like product design, media, technology, and marketing. Through coursework, students learn to solve design issues and define, discover, develop, and deliver interesting designs by using communication and information technology. Additionally, graduates improve their abilities to execute, create, and evaluate a variety of communication strategies, often incorporating UX/UI principles. Multimedia design degree students can use their skills to develop a professional portfolio of their design work for future employment consideration.

Many programs allow students to select a concentration within their degree. Learners can focus their education on a variety of topics, including web design and development, game art, motion graphics, and user experience (UX) design. Each university offers its own unique multimedia design degree. Some programs require capstones, a thesis, or final projects. Be sure to consider whether your program requires on–campus immersions for online students or if coursework takes place entirely online.

Curriculum for an Online Bachelor’s Degree in Multimedia Design

Digital Multimedia Design Foundations
Introducing students to concepts, skills, principles, and language, the digital multimedia design foundations course gives students an overview of the tools they need to succeed in multimedia design.
Animation Fundamentals
Teaching students to create animated works that communicate ideas, the animation fundamentals course explores the importance of animation to inspire critical reflection and enhance user interaction.
Graphic Applications in Print Communications
In this course, students learn about the concepts, issues, and practice involved with contemporary design strategies for advertising, public relations, and digital or print communications.
Design Thinking and Creativity
The design thinking and creativity course gives students an instruction and multidisciplinary exploration of the process, theory, methods, and artifacts of design through an examination of applications, examples, and ideas.
Advanced Multimedia Production
The advanced multimedia production course allows students to work in multimedia production by using video editing, audio editing, animation software, web authoring, and image editing.

Careers with a Bachelor’s in Multimedia Design

Graduates of multimedia design programs can find employment in infographics, marketing, advertising, or web–based design, depending on the area of their expertise. Multimedia design careers require professionals to be creative in a way that appeals to different clients.

Special Effects Artists and Animators
Special effects artists and animators create two- and three-dimensional models, visual effects, and animation for movies, television, video games, and other media. These professionals use various computer programs and illustrations as they create animations and graphics while working with a team of other artists and animators.
  • Median Annual Salary: $99,800
  • Projected Growth Rate: 2%
Graphic Designers
Responsible for creating visual concepts, graphic designers communicate ideas that inform, inspire, and captivate consumers. They develop layouts and production designs for a variety of applications, including brochures, magazines, corporate reports, and advertisements.
  • Median Annual Salary: $61,300
  • Projected Growth Rate: 2%
Web Developers and Digital Designers
Web developers design and maintain websites. These professionals use the site’s technical aspects, such as performance and capacity, to measure the website’s speed and how much traffic the site can handle. Web developers often create site content.
  • Median Annual Salary: $95,380
  • Projected Growth Rate: 7%
